Purpose
The mission of this Chancellor’s Advisory Committee on Sustainability (CACS) Working Group on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ion in Sustainability is to identify and recommend policies, practices and strategies that elevate and integrate an intersectional approach towards diversity, equity, and inclusivity in campus sustainability initiatives. The group seeks to strengthen the diversity, equity, and inclusion of the UC Berkeley undergraduate, graduate and professional student, faculty, and staff populations contributing to sustainable practices. We will develop recommendations, cultivate a sense of belonging in sustainability spaces, and situate environmental and social justice as central pillars of campus sustainability efforts, including in operations/administration, co-curricular learning activities, and physical planning.
Members
The working group includes representatives from the UC Berkeley Office of Sustainability, Parking & Transportation, Student Environmental Resource Center, Basic Needs Center, Rausser College of Natural Resources, African American Student Development Office, Students of Color Environmental Collective, and Chancellor’s Advisory Committee on Sustainability.
